如何搭建Velog本地开发环境:从克隆代码到运行服务的详细指南
【免费下载链接】velog 项目地址: https://gitcode.com/gh_mirrors/ve/velog
Velog是一个功能强大的开源博客平台,本指南将带你快速完成从代码克隆到本地服务运行的全过程,让你轻松开启Velog的开发之旅。
1. 克隆代码仓库
首先,你需要将Velog项目代码克隆到本地。打开终端,执行以下命令:
git clone https://gitcode.com/gh_mirrors/ve/velog
2. 安装项目依赖
Velog项目包含多个子模块,需要分别安装依赖。
2.1 安装后端依赖
进入velog-backend目录,执行npm install安装依赖:
cd velog/velog-backend
npm install
2.2 安装前端依赖
进入velog-frontend目录,执行npm install安装依赖:
cd ../velog-frontend
npm install
2.3 安装SSR依赖
进入velog-ssr目录,执行npm install安装依赖:
cd ../velog-ssr
npm install
3. 配置环境变量
在每个子模块目录下,都有一个env.sample.json文件,你需要将其复制为env.json并根据实际情况修改配置。
以velog-backend为例:
cd velog-backend
cp env.sample.json env.json
然后编辑env.json文件,配置数据库连接等信息。
4. 启动开发服务
4.1 启动后端服务
在velog-backend目录下,执行以下命令启动后端开发服务:
npm run dev
4.2 启动前端服务
在velog-frontend目录下,执行以下命令启动前端开发服务:
npm start
4.3 启动SSR服务
在velog-ssr目录下,执行以下命令启动SSR开发服务:
npm run dev
5. 访问本地服务
所有服务启动成功后,你可以通过以下地址访问Velog本地开发环境:
- 前端服务:http://localhost:3000
- 后端API:http://localhost:4000
- SSR服务:http://localhost:4001
6. 常见问题解决
6.1 依赖安装失败
如果遇到依赖安装失败,可以尝试使用yarn代替npm:
yarn install
6.2 服务启动失败
检查环境变量配置是否正确,特别是数据库连接信息。如果数据库连接失败,请确保本地数据库服务已启动。
6.3 端口占用
如果提示端口占用,可以修改配置文件中的端口号,或者关闭占用端口的进程。
通过以上步骤,你已经成功搭建了Velog本地开发环境。现在,你可以开始探索Velog的源代码,进行二次开发或贡献代码了。祝你开发顺利!
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考




